North West : Corporate and commercial

Within Corporate and commercial: Manchester, Pinsent Masons LLP is a first tier firm,

Pinsent Masons LLP’s ‘very commercial and pragmatic team takes the time to get to know a client’s business’. Its strength remains private equity transactions, and corporate head Gregg Davison recently advised CPBE Capital on the £148m cross-border Stewart Group sale. Office head Helen Ridgedemonstrates an ability to be resourceful and flexible’ on corporate transactions. Commercial lawyer Samantha Livesey joined from Pannone LLP, and is ‘always excellent: very proactive, bright and knowledgeable (and always friendly)’. Her clients include Morrison, BASF, Serco and AJ Bell.

North West : Finance

Within Banking and finance, Pinsent Masons LLP is a second tier firm,

Pinsent Masons LLP has a strong lender client base, acting for names including The Co-Operative Bank, Lloyds Banking Group and HSBC. ‘Pragmatic and good to work with’, Matt Morgan leads on real estate and corporate financings, recently acting for HSBC on funding a private equity backed MBO of Intrinsic Technology. The firm’s merger with McGrigors LLP added the capabilities of a team led by Samantha Rollason, who is ‘extremely commercial and gives good-quality, sensible advice’.

Within Insolvency and corporate recovery, Pinsent Masons LLP is a second tier firm,

Jamie White leads Pinsent Masons LLP’s national restructuring practice. The Manchester team advised H.I.G. European Capital Partners on the acquisition of Silentnight Group, and Grant Thornton on the receivership of the Free Trade Hall Hotel. Senior associate James Cameron is recommended.

North West : Overview

Within Regional overview, Pinsent Masons LLP is a first tier firm,

Pinsent Masons LLP’s merger with McGrigors LLP added strength and depth to its construction, projects, energy and finance offerings, and closer ties to a local client base. Its core practices in projects and construction are increasingly focusing on international matters. The firm is also a leading player regionally for private equity mandates.

Within Construction, Pinsent Masons LLP is a first tier firm,

Pinsent Masons LLP is praised for its ‘first-class service and almost limitless wealth of construction knowledge’. The five-partner team includes Michael Hopkins, who is ‘measured and strategically strong’; the ‘knowledgeableChris Hallam; and Andrew Denton, who present ‘clear, concise advice in a succinct style’. The firm handles the full spectrum of contentious and non-contentious work, in the nuclear, energy and public sectors among others. It is advising the Homes and Communities Agency on an exhibition centre and hotel development at Liverpool docks, and contractor ISG in a PPP between Sport England and Serco. The firm’s merger with McGrigors LLP brought over a well-regarded three-partner team that includes transactional lawyer Peter Blackmore.
